你查询的IP:[122.51.185.5]  地理位置:中国–上海–上海

最新查询119.84.0.143 123.184.191.2 202.164.201.157 210.51.5.29 120.76.48.114 121.59.61.242 121.40.138.78 124.64.166.143 123.249.131.182 122.51.185.5 119.148.160.56 118.80.116.141 121.60.129.227 125.171.217.186 124.67.64.168 203.100.96.191 58.192.74.113 122.112.199.250 123.249.18.141 202.74.8.106 124.128.156.144 202.189.80.57 116.204.40.113 202.38.156.3 211.160.237.7 203.209.224.122 123.244.133.223 221.8.108.192 119.75.208.211 202.127.160.157 116.52.37.137